Regulation 13

of House to House and Street Collections Regulations 1976

Regulation 13

Form of account

Any account furnished under regulation 12 must —

(a)

where money or property has been collected or property has been sold, be in the form set out in the Fourth Schedule, and in either case must —

(i)

if the total amount of money collected, including the proceeds derived from the sale of property exceed $10,000, be certified by the chief promoter of the collection and by a public accountant who is appointed by the organisation of the chief promoter to be the auditor of the account; or

(ii)

if the total amount of money collected, including the proceeds derived from the sale of property does not exceed $10,000, be certified by an independent person who is from among persons whom the Commissioner of Police determines to have the requisite ability and practical experience to carry out a competent examination, and who is appointed by the organisation of the chief promoter to be the auditor of the account; and

(b)

where other property has been collected and given away, be in the form set out in the Fourth Schedule, and be certified by the chief promoter and every person responsible for giving away the property.
